Brief Title: Prospective Evaluation of Needle Exsufflation for Pneumothorax

Official Title: Impact of Pneumothorax Duration Before Treatment on the Success of Needle Exsufflation

Brief Summary: Monocentric observational study of needle exsufflation for pneumothorax in the ICU.
Detailed Description: The main objective of this prospective observational non interventional study is to investigate a possible relationship between prior duration of pneumothorax (defined as the duration from first occurence of chest pain reported by patient to exsufflation) and the success of exsufflation procedure (defined by the absence of a chest tube insertion in the following 24h).
